Top 5 Basement Floor Finishes
Here are the top 5 basement floor finishes that are highly recommended by homeowners and contractors alike:
1. Epoxy Coating
Epoxy coating is a popular choice for basement floors due to its durability, stain resistance, and low maintenance. This finish is ideal for basements that are prone to moisture, as it provides a waterproof barrier. Epoxy coating comes in a variety of colors and can be customized to match your desired aesthetic.
2. Polyurethane Coating
Polyurethane coating is another popular option for basement floors. It provides a glossy finish, is easy to clean, and resistant to scratches. This finish is ideal for basements with high foot traffic or those that will be used as a home gym or play area.
3. Ceramic Tile
Ceramic tile is a great option for basements that are prone to moisture. It's waterproof, easy to clean, and provides a slip-resistant surface. Ceramic tile comes in a wide range of styles, colors, and patterns, making it easy to match your desired aesthetic.
4. Laminate Flooring
Laminate flooring is a cost-effective option for basement floors. It's durable, easy to install, and provides a natural wood look without the high cost. Laminate flooring is ideal for basements that will be used as a home office or guest room.
5. Concrete Stain
Concrete stain is a popular choice for basements with existing concrete floors. It's a cost-effective option that provides a unique, industrial look. Concrete stain is easy to apply and can be customized to match your desired color and pattern.
Factors to Consider When Choosing a Basement Floor Finish
When choosing a basement floor finish, there are several factors to consider, including:
- Moisture levels: If your basement is prone to moisture, you'll want to choose a finish that's waterproof or resistant to water damage.
- Foot traffic: If your basement will be used as a high-traffic area, you'll want to choose a finish that's durable and easy to clean.
- Aesthetic appeal: Consider the overall look and feel you want to achieve in your basement. Do you want a modern, industrial look or a cozy, rustic feel?
- Budget: Determine how much you're willing to spend on your basement floor finish. Different finishes vary significantly in price.
